I think the only other thing that's new on the writing front is Little Lost Dryad, a short story in the dryad sequence that includes potential child abuse, and the revenge for that. I had a rather lame ending, but some of the feedback was pointed and direct, and has resulted in my rewriting parts of the beginning to put in more detail, and rewriting the ending completely. We'll see how it turns out, I'm not totally satisfied with it in this form, either.

What would make me satisfied? Hmm, good question. The ending has to be something that could only come about because the narrator is a dryad, that the narrator does, and is emotionally satisfying (a short story, for me, is as much about emotion as it is anything else).
